John Edwards elected to Sandhurst Town Council

  • Tweet
Monday, 22 November, 2021
John Edwards - Sandhurst Town Council

John Edwards won a close election to take his place representing Central Sandhurst on the Sandhurst Town Council.

The election took place on 18th November 2021 and John was supported by local Conservative Councillors and members who joined him in canvassing in the ward.   

His fellow councillor all agreed that It is great to be able to get out and meet with residents again.

Sandhurst Town Council - Canvassing

John now looks forwards to representing his community on the council.

Sandhurst comprises the electoral wards of Central Sandhurst, College Town, Little Sandhurst and Owlsmoor each of which has elected representatives on the Sandhurst Town Council and the the Bracknell Forest Borough Council.
